A Summer Afternoon That Changed Everything

Back in June, our client Maria was driving home from her late shift at a medical supply warehouse. The sun was still high, kids were riding bikes through sprinklers, and her only plan that day was to cook dinner and enjoy a quiet evening with her family.

As she approached a busy intersection in Manchester, the light turned green. She entered cautiously — and never saw what hit her.

A distracted driver blew through his red light at nearly 50 mph, striking the driver’s side of her SUV. The impact left her vehicle spun into a curb, airbags deployed, driver’s door crushed inward. Witnesses later reported the other driver had been looking down at his phone moments before the collision.

Injuries That Don’t Show on the Outside

At Hartford Hospital, doctors diagnosed:

  • A concussion
  • Cervical sprain
  • Shoulder injury
  • Lower back injury

She was discharged with a neck brace, pain medication, and orders to follow up with orthopedics and physical therapy.

Within days, reality set in:

  • She couldn’t return to work
  • Bills began piling up
  • Her short-term disability stalled
  • The insurance adjuster kept calling, asking for recorded statements and medical releases she didn’t understand

Meanwhile, her kids watched summer slip by while their mother struggled just to get out of bed.

Taking on the Fight

From the moment she came into our office, we knew Maria didn’t just need a lawyer — she needed protection, clarity, and a plan.

We immediately:

  • Took over communication with the insurance companies
  • Secured intersection camera footage
  • Located witnesses and obtained sworn statements
  • Coordinated her specialist appointments and PT
  • Calculated her lost wages and future medical needs
  • Built a complete liability and damages case

The defense pushed back hard, denying responsibility and minimizing her injuries. They claimed her crash “wasn’t that serious.” They suggested her symptoms were “pre-existing.” They dragged out document requests and depositions for months.

But while they tried to run out the clock, Maria kept fighting through treatment. And we kept fighting for her.

A Breakthrough — Right Before the Holidays

By October, the medical picture was clear: her injuries were real, her pain was ongoing, and the crash had permanently changed her life. Her orthopedic specialist projected future care costs, strengthening our damages claim.

With trial preparations underway, the insurance carrier came back with a dramatically increased offer — a six-figure settlement recognizing:

  • Medical expenses
  • Future medical care
  • Lost wages
  • Pain and suffering
  • Emotional distress
  • Loss of life enjoyment

The final negotiations wrapped in early December.
